Adecco is currently hiring a Mechanical Assembler for a full-time opportunity in a manufacturing environment. This role is ideal for mechanically inclined individuals who enjoy hands-on work, working with tools and equipment, and assembling high-quality products in a fast-paced production setting.
In this position, you will be responsible for assembling mechanical components and systems according to engineering drawings, specifications, and established production procedures.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, safety-focused, and comfortable working with both large and intricate components.

Responsibilities
Read, interpret, and follow blueprints, engineering drawings, diagrams, specifications, and written instructions
Assemble mechanical equipment and components according to required specifications and procedures
Use hand tools and power tools to complete mechanical assembly tasks
Install interconnecting piping, components, and support structures
Ensure proper fitting, adjustment, and alignment of components to meet inspection standards and close tolerances
Work with materials and parts of various sizes, from heavy components to small intricate pieces
Assist with final system assembly and installation at customer sites when required
Support Team Leads, Electrical teams, and Test teams to help achieve manufacturing goals
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ment
Follow all company safety policies and procedures
Report safety concerns, near misses, and incidents immediately
Contribute ideas for continuous improvement and process optimization
Perform other related duties as assigned
